  6. Hey guys. I purchased a 2023 Audi A4 from the dealership with 26k, and I ended up belatedly realizing it came with the following issue: The transmission splash shield is missing. I purchased a new one on ebay, and I found screws that will work for all holes except the rearmost 2 that actually attach to the transmission. The hole is very large for these two, and I'm having trouble finding expanding clips that are big enough to expand into this hole, and also cover the diameter on the shield itself. I found a 60-pack retainer clip kit at Autozone that has 2 in it that should work, but the whole kit is 30 bucks, and I'm not 100% sure they'll work so I held off. According to the online OEM shops, This is the rivet I need. However, I can see from the image that this is way to small. I was hoping someone could post a picture of the undercarriage showing how these two holes are fastened. I feel like I'm missing something here, because the holes are just too large on the transmission.
